2bRogerExcellent content presented in regrettably irritating style1. Adding what I hope is constructive criticism to augment my earlier review. I wonder if Senator Cruz and his "co-host" are aware of a vocal tic, now proliferating among American public speakers, that make this otherwise fine podcast all but impossible to listen to for more than two or three minutes. I refer to the rapid-fire repetition of conjunctions, articles, pronouns, and other short, usually monosyllabic words . Often the speaker repeats the beginning consonants only before spitting out the entire word. The habit resembles a stutter, but is not a stutter. It lends to nearly every sentence a distracting discordant stumbling rhythm that seems to get worse as a speaker becomes more animated or passionate. By no means limited to Sen Cruz and his sidekick, this staccato discord has quickly become ubiquitous among talking heads, and seems to be highly contagious. It's infinitely harder on the ears than old school oratorical foibles like "um," "uh," "you know," etc.. Example: "Th-th-the immigrants are-are streaming across the border in unprecedented numbers, an-and this is exactly what the-the-the Democrats an-an-and the Biden Administration want to happen. Th-th-th-they are coming from all over the world an-and-and-and they are allowed to cross the border and -and in many cases without any effective vetting are-are-are released into the country. An-an-an-and I gotta tell you, nobody has any idea who these people are or-or -or what their intentions are." And-And-And so forth. Very irritating. 2.
